Okres Žďár nad Sázavou, a region in the heart of the Czech Republic's Vysočina Region, is defined by its consistently undulating landscape, dense forests, and numerous reservoirs. A significant portion of okres Žďár nad Sázavou falls within the Žďárské vrchy Protected Landscape Area, offering a diverse environment for outdoor activities. The area's hilly terrain, part of the Křižanov Highlands, provides varied conditions suitable for several sports like hiking, mountain biking, touring cycling, jogging, and more.

Key natural attractions include the Žďárské vrchy Protected Landscape Area, featuring formations like Nine Rocks (Devět skal), the highest point at 836 meters (2,743 feet). Other notable sites are Lisovská skála and Peperek Hill, both offering unique geological features. The Pilská Reservoir is the largest body of water, used for recreation.
The region integrates outdoor activities with visits to significant cultural sites. The Pilgrimage Church of St. John of Nepomuk at Zelená Hora,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, is a prominent attraction. Pernštejn Castle, an unconquered fortress with nearly eight centuries of history, also offers cultural experiences.

The highest point in the Žďárské vrchy, and the second highest in the Bohemian-Moravian Highlands, is Nine Rocks (Devět skal), reaching 836 meters (2,743 feet) above sea level. Holý kopec, at 665 meters (2,182 feet), is the highest point in the immediate vicinity of the town of Žďár nad Sázavou.
